• 专利标题: 一种利用软件水印限制非法JAVA软件运行的方法
  • 专利标题(英): Method for restricting illegal JAVA software operation by using software watermarks
  • 申请号: CN201010621775.2
    申请日: 2010-12-24
  • 公开(公告)号: CN102122335B
    公开(公告)日: 2012-11-14
  • 发明人: 王建民王朝坤余志伟戴鹏飞
  • 申请人: 清华大学
  • 申请人地址: 北京市海淀区清华园1号
  • 专利权人: 清华大学
  • 当前专利权人: 清华大学
  • 当前专利权人地址: 北京市海淀区清华园1号
  • 代理机构: 北京清亦华知识产权代理事务所
  • 代理商 罗文群
  • 主分类号: G06F21/22
  • IPC分类号: G06F21/22
一种利用软件水印限制非法JAVA软件运行的方法
摘要:
本发明涉及一种利用软件水印限制非法JAVA软件运行的方法,属于软件保护技术领域。首先在用户提交的JAVA软件中嵌入水印,然后在JAVA软件运行系统中构建一个JAVA软件水印提取模块和一个JAVA软件水印验证模块,利用水印提取模块中的水印提取方法,从用户提交的JAVA软件中提取水印,对提取的水印进行验证,以确定用户提交的JAVA软件的合法性。本发明方法隐秘性好,安全性高,对于恶意软件的攻击有很好的抗攻击能力;本方法中软件水印的提取时间短,嵌入水印后的软件仍能保持良好的运行性能;本方法具有良好的移植性,能够根据用户需求来选择水印方法,因此可以更好地满足用户对JAVA软件运行安全性和运行效率的需求。
0/0